
Capitals ink defenseman Trevor Byrne
July 25, 2006 - American Hockey League (AHL)
Hershey Bears News Release
HERSHEY - The 2006 Calder Cup Champion HERSHEY BEARS have announced in conjunction with the NHL's Washington Capitals that defenseman Trevor Byrne has signed an NHL two-way contract for the next two seasons. Per club policy, financial terms of the agreement were not disclosed. The announcement was made today jointly by BEARS President/GM Doug Yingst and Capitals VP/General Manager George McPhee.
Byrne played in 51 games for the AHL's Peoria Rivermen in 2005-06, scoring three goals and notching 21 points. Originally drafted by the St. Louis Blues in the fifth round of the 1999 NHL Entry Draft, the Weymouth, MA native played four seasons for Dartmouth prior to turning pro. Standing at 6'3" and weighing 205 lbs, Byrne brings 154 games of AHL experience to the Washington organization.
